«I am the most qualified candidate and also the only one capable of beating Donald Trump». This is why I want to stay in the race, «to finish the job».

Joe Biden reiterated this during the press conference at the end of the NATO summit in Washington.

But, in front of journalists, the 81-year-old US president accompanied the resoluteness of his statements with the usual, now inevitable gaffes, which continue to make many - especially in the democratic home - doubt his lucidity.

Indeed, Biden introduced Ukrainian President Volodymyr Zelensky as "Putin" and spoke of his deputy Kamala Harris as "Trump".

And Trump himself, his rival in the autumn presidential elections, did not fail to take advantage of the two slips to comment, ironically, on his social network Truth: «Well done Joe! Good job!".

According to some rumors, after the summit, former Speaker of the House Nancy Pelosi (Democrat) and former President Barack Obama spoke on the phone. A discussion with on the table - once again - the ways to find an "exit strategy" for the elderly president before the Dem convention in August.

Seventeen deputies and one senator are currently pushing for Biden's step back. The front, however, could continue to widen.
